Dave Hershberger
1c1bb6e0be
1.5.5
2012-11-15 13:09:44 -08:00
Dave Hershberger
4f690e9bee
Added .count field (of 1) to every PointCloud2 field description.
...
This fixes the bug referred to here: http://dev.pointclouds.org/issues/821 which is useful because that fix in PCL
seems not to be released yet.
Also this way is more correct, as far as I can tell.
2012-11-15 13:07:51 -08:00
Dave Hershberger
1ab017c6d9
Tidied up CMakeLists.txt based on Dirk's recommendations.
2012-10-16 15:47:44 -07:00
Dave Hershberger
51624109ba
1.5.4
2012-10-10 15:07:55 -07:00
Dave Hershberger
8d1e77dfe5
added install rules to CMakeLists.txt needed for catkinization.
2012-10-10 14:14:36 -07:00
Dave Hershberger
fb43f21a81
catkinized
2012-10-09 15:26:16 -07:00
Vincent Rabaud
3b3cd8d129
revert to the angles package
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@40134 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2012-09-16 00:55:55 +00:00
Vincent Rabaud
2759d7b7a6
more angles fixing
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@40123 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2012-09-15 20:45:21 +00:00
Vincent Rabaud
9d36e65ef5
angles has been renames to geometry_angles_utils in Groovy
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@40121 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2012-09-15 20:41:22 +00:00
Brian Gerkey
9ee890e2b8
added missing header
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@38521 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2012-01-14 02:51:28 +00:00
Vincent Rabaud
6cebfa088a
use the new bullet and eigen conventions
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@38342 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-12-13 22:29:05 +00:00
Jeremy Leibs
ae5a7968da
Moving back to eigen from eigen3
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35794 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-02-07 19:17:40 +00:00
Jeremy Leibs
2d1b9b5416
Rolling back change to laser_geometry/src/laser_geometry.cpp
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35367 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-20 17:50:52 +00:00
Jeremy Leibs
1bf397f575
Removing unnecessary exports
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35366 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-20 17:49:54 +00:00
Jeremy Leibs
9c8817ba97
Unit tests are actually passing now
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35276 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-16 08:42:54 +00:00
Jeremy Leibs
ae9141d36d
Fixing the tests in laser_geometry -- now they break
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35275 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-16 04:45:46 +00:00
Jeremy Leibs
b59d080add
Adding call to FAIL which never gets reached
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35267 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-15 03:12:01 +00:00
Jeremy Leibs
3a00224b10
Starting to add unit tests for PointCloud2
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35266 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-15 02:50:28 +00:00
Jeremy Leibs
92e6c455c6
Just using internal co_sine_map for LaserProjection
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35260 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 21:32:56 +00:00
Jeremy Leibs
4fafc67ab6
removing deprecation warnigns
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35257 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 21:18:20 +00:00
Eitan Marder-Eppstein
47fde33dec
Fixing bug in how data is copied
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35248 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 09:51:37 +00:00
Eitan Marder-Eppstein
a85006555f
We know offset_shift is always 4, makes things a lot simpler
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35246 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 09:40:31 +00:00
Eitan Marder-Eppstein
c72d74c7fb
Fixing a bug in computing the offset shift
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35245 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 09:38:24 +00:00
Eitan Marder-Eppstein
3582dd2558
Making sure to give the user back the channel or fields that they ask for and no additional ones when transforming from laser scans to poincloud and pointcloud2
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35244 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 09:35:45 +00:00
Eitan Marder-Eppstein
acd1b0411f
We filter the point cloud so its not dense
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35243 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 09:01:50 +00:00
Eitan Marder-Eppstein
e5a51cf5c3
Removing laser_scan_geometry files from the package
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35239 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 08:05:50 +00:00
Eitan Marder-Eppstein
063550e67c
Updating transformLaserScanToPointCloud_ to use the index channel rather than replicating all the work of the original projection. This also gets rid of an unnecessary intermediate PointCloud. It does, however, require that an index channel is always generated when a user calls the function. The overhead is low if it goes unused... not sure how big a deal this is
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35238 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 08:05:48 +00:00
Eitan Marder-Eppstein
3f5ba8926a
Adding support for PointCloud2 to the laser projector, removing a bunch of deprecated functions, and fixing a ton of warnings
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@35237 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2011-01-14 08:05:45 +00:00
Radu Rusu
9287eff456
added the new LaserScan->PointCloud2 geometry class
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@34348 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2010-11-30 02:13:43 +00:00
Brian Gerkey
a612b35430
Added Ubuntu platform tags to manifest
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@29657 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2010-05-19 20:25:31 +00:00
John Hsu
81bcc63259
fix possible race condition per ticket #3802
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@27698 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2010-02-09 00:50:38 +00:00
Jeremy Leibs
735e86948f
Updating stack/manifest.xml files
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@26801 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2010-01-10 17:50:56 +00:00
Jeremy Leibs
4c6e81b827
Applying patch for #3550
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@26796 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2010-01-09 04:52:34 +00:00
Jeremy Leibs
671ec17afe
Resolved some float->double conversion errors to fix the tolerances for #1651
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@26612 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2010-01-07 19:29:45 +00:00
Rob Wheeler
77f5de54ee
Remove use of deprecated rosbuild macros
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@25975 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-12-01 01:20:33 +00:00
Tully Foote
2175503845
patching laser projection to work with inverted mode #3041
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@25120 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-10-12 22:28:38 +00:00
Jeremy Leibs
136cf0c3b8
Pulling laser processing out of laser geomtry for 0.9.0 release.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24513 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-25 20:29:41 +00:00
Jeremy Leibs
72f5987e54
More laser_geometry documentation.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24362 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-23 17:04:11 +00:00
Jeremy Leibs
86f1e5b7a9
Fixing documentation in laser_geometry.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24354 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-23 03:42:18 +00:00
Jeremy Leibs
9205f96a65
More laser_geometry documentation.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24351 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-23 02:57:38 +00:00
Jeremy Leibs
28004cb5da
laser_geometry fixes to documentation
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24346 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-23 01:45:33 +00:00
Jeremy Leibs
ac4a77f57a
More laser_geometry deprecations and code fixes.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24345 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-23 01:37:30 +00:00
Jeremy Leibs
f7b67fb1b8
Deprecating preservative and fixing up documentation.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24323 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-22 21:26:12 +00:00
Jeremy Leibs
5bd2038978
Removing include of ros/node.h from laser_processor.h
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24146 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-17 22:53:42 +00:00
Jeremy Leibs
b5c8e966f2
Deprecating laser_processor.h
...
git-svn-id: https://code.ros.org/svn/ros-pkg/stacks/laser_pipeline/trunk@24121 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-17 02:49:20 +00:00
Jeremy Leibs
0d240201c4
Somehow managed to not fix the laser_geomety test itself.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/pkg/trunk/stacks/laser_pipeline@23530 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-01 14:05:37 +00:00
Jeremy Leibs
58e93bb190
Merging in remaining missing contents for laser_piple that svn ignored on the first merge.
...
git-svn-id: https://code.ros.org/svn/ros-pkg/pkg/trunk/stacks/laser_pipeline@23510 eb33c2ac-9c88-4c90-87e0-44a10359b0c3
2009-09-01 08:18:14 +00:00